I'm using Snow Leopard, and I'm finding it unbelievably frustrating that I can only resize windows using a single corner. Is there something I can install that will let me resize any window with any edge/corner?

The only way I have seen to do this in Snow Leopard is through the addition of an application such as Right Zoom or Mega Zoomer. Until you can move to Lion it seems this is your primary option unless you want to write your own scripts to do it.

You can also use an application like Moom or Divvy if you want to resize the windows via hotkeys, but I haven't seen an any-edge resizing solution.
